Cooking Claire Baked Brie in Bread Bowl

Preparation.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C). Cut off the top of the bread boule so the top surface is flat and without crust. Slice the crusty top into sticks and set aside. Set the brie wheel on top of the bread and cut out a hole for the brie. Set the brie aside and remove the cut out bread.

Brie in Sourdough Bread Bowl Recipe Do It All Working Mom

Instructions. Preheat oven to 425°F. Take the brie and use it to roughly measure a circle on the bread. Then carefully cut out the circle in the bread, making sure not to go through the bottom. Pull out the bread from the center and tear it into small chunks. Add to a baking tray and drizzle with olive oil.

Cooking Claire Baked Brie in Bread Bowl

Instructions.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Carefully cut the top out of a sourdough bread bowl (a small, sharp knife is best). Scoop the rest of the bowl out to create a hollow for the Brie Cheese wheel to sit in. Place the bread bowl on a baking tray lined with parchment paper or in a cast iron dish.
